[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]My DC is at Davidson receiving FA and is also working 8 hours a week. The job has been great for adding structure to DC's routine and the money has also been helpful. DC earns about $200 a month which has been more than enough to cover extras that arise. Davidson also has Lula Bell's, a great resource for all students; but extra support is available for those who need it most. https://www.davidson.edu/offices-and-services/civic-engagement/lula-bells-resource-center Davidson definitely has some full-pay students, but according to their website, "about 51 percent of our students receive need-based aid, and 70 percent receive aid from some source." [/quote] Davidson, no question. Tons of high-paying financial services jobs in Charlotte, and Davidson would be supportive. Texas would squash the kid like a big. I hate the posters here who call everyone delusional, but thinking a regular bright poor kid from an iffy high school should jump into a top CS program is delusional. The kid would be up against who are likely somewhat brighter and much better prepared. And most employers really don’t care where an applicant who can code went to school. Normal bright students are much better off in supportive programs than killer weedout programs. [/quote]
